Fall
While Long Island summers are drawing huge NYC crowds, those of us who live here know that fall is simply the best season of all. The summer gangs have left, the beaches sparkle clean and clear and now belong to us once more. The waters are still warm enough to indulge in all sorts of water sports, the restaurants haven't closed for the season yet and all along Long Island's North Fork, farm stands are bustling and pumpkin picking for the kids along with wine tastings for the grown-ups are in full swing. And as for the colors and light - well, they're simply beautiful!
